Former Virginia Commonwealth University standouts Brandon Inge and Scott Sizemore continue to build the VCU baseball tradition long after their collegiate days in Richmond.  Following Major League Baseball’s All-Star festivities, the Rams accomplished a feat no other baseball program in the country can claim.

DID YOU KNOW?

VCU was the only school in the nation to be represented in the XM Futures All-Star Game (Sizemore), which showcases the top prospects in Major League Baseball, and the MLB All-Star Game (Inge) and Home Run Derby (Inge).

The Rams joined Miami (Ryan Braun & Jemile Weeks), Long Beach State (Evan Longoria & Danny Espinosa) and Arizona State (Dustin Pedroia & Brett Wallace) as one of only four programs in the country to be represented in the Futures Game and All-Star Game.
